California’s Latest Gift to the Public Employee Unions is Challenged in Federal Court
On Tuesday, seven elected officials from various local government bodies challenged a recently enacted California state law that prohibits a public employer from “deter[ing] or discourag[ing] public employees from becoming or remaining members” of a...
